[Bug 1936970] Re: [MIR] libnet-snmp-perl as a dependency of amavisd-new
I fear that you mixed up two packages here:
libnet-snmp-perl 6.0.1 with the Perl module Net::SNMP from
https://metacpan.org/dist/Net-SNMP (unchanged upstream since 2010).
and
libsnmp-perl 5.9(.1) with the Perl modules SNMP and NetSNMP::* from
https://net-snmp.sourceforge.io/ and http://github.com/net-snmp/net-
snmp/
I don't know which of them is used by amavisd-ng, but libnet-snmp-perl
6.0.1 isn't updated upstream since 2010, but is actively maintained by
the Debian Perl team (including me).
